|
|
|
รบกวนพี่ๆช่วยดูโค้ดให้หน่อยครับ บันทึกรูป ชื่อรูปไม่ลงฐานข้อมูล ครับ |
|
|
|
|
|
|
|
Code (PHP)
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Untitled Document</title>
</head>
<body>
<?php
include("connDB.php") ;
mysql_select_db($db) ;
$echo = "Program by </a>
" ;
$result = mysql_query("select * from member where username='$_SESSION[login_true]'") or die ("Err Can not to result") ;
$dbarr = mysql_fetch_array($result) ;
?>
<form action="" method="post" enctype="multipart/form-data" name="form1" id="form1">
<fieldset>
<legend>ข้อมูลทั่วไปเกี่ยวกับสถานที่ฝึกงาน</legend>
<table width="563" border="1" align="center" cellpadding="0" cellspacing="0">
<tr>
<td colspan="2"><div align="center">
<legend>ข้อมูลทั่วไปเกี่ยวกับสถานที่ฝึกงาน</legend>
</div></td>
</tr>
<tr>
<td width="261"><div align="right">ชื่อหน่วยงาน</div></td>
<td width="296"><input type="text" name="organization" /></td>
</tr>
<tr>
<td><div align="right">หัวหน้าที่หน่วยงานชื่อ</div></td>
<td><input type="text" name="chief" /></td>
</tr>
<tr>
<td><div align="right">ตำแหน่ง</div></td>
<td><input type="text" name="position" /></td>
</tr>
<tr>
<td><div align="right">ที่อยู่หน่วยงาน</div></td>
<td><textarea name="address"></textarea></td>
</tr>
<tr>
<td><div align="right">ลักษณะงานขององค์การ</div></td>
<td><textarea name="nature"></textarea></td>
</tr>
<tr>
<td><div align="right">ประวัติองค์การโดยย่อ</div></td>
<td><textarea name="history"></textarea></td>
</tr>
<tr>
<td><div align="right">จำนวนพนักงาน</div></td>
<td><input type="text" name="number" /></td>
</tr>
<tr>
<td><div align="right">ลักษณะการดำเนินงาน</div></td>
<td><textarea name="job"></textarea></td>
</tr>
<tr>
<td><div align="right">แผนภูมิการจัดองค์การ</div></td>
<td><input type="file" name="chart" /></td>
</tr>
<tr>
<td><div align="right">แผนที่/สถานที่ตั้งหน่วยงาน</div></td>
<td><label>
<input type="file" name="map" />
</label></td>
</tr>
<tr>
<td colspan="2"><label>
<div align="center"><font size="2" face="MS Sans Serif, Tahoma, sans-serif">
<input name="username" type="hidden" value="<?php echo $dbarr['username'] ;?>" />
</font>
<input type="submit" name="Submit" value="Upload" />
</div>
</label></td>
</tr>
</table>
</fieldset>
</form>
</body>
</html>
<?php include "connDB.php"; ?>
<?php
if($_POST[Submit]){
$sql = "INSERT INTO agencies(id_org,organization,chief,position,address,nature,history,number,job,chart,map,username)VALUES('$_POST[id_org]',
'$_POST[organization]',
'$_POST[chief]',
'$_POST[position]',
'$_POST[address]',
'$_POST[nature]',
'$_POST[history]',
'$_POST[number]',
'$_POST[job]',
'$_FILES[chart][name]',
'$_FILES[map][name]',
'$_SESSION[login_true]')";
$chart = $_FILES['chart'];
if($chart['name']!=''){
$chart_tmp = $chart['tmp_name'];
$file_name=str_replace(" ","_",$chart['name']);
$result_filename = "files/$file_name";
if(move_uploaded_file($chart_tmp,$result_filename)){
$result = mysql_query("INSERT INTO files (file_name,file_size,file_type,user_update,update_date) values ('$filename','$file_size','$file_type',".$_SESSION['SESUser_ID']."',now(),".$_SESSION['SESUser_ID'].",now())");
}
}
$map=$_FILES['map'];
if($map['name']!=''){
$map_tmpname = $map['tmp_name'];
$file_name=str_replace(" ","_",$map['name']);
$result_filename = "files/$file_name";
if(move_uploaded_file($map_tmpname,$result_filename)){
$result = mysql_query("INSERT INTO files (file_name,file_size,file_type,user_update,update_date) values ('$filename','$file_size','$file_type',".$_SESSION['SESUser_ID']."',now(),".$_SESSION['SESUser_ID'].",now())");
}
/*if(!empty($_FILES['file']['name']))
{
$file_name = $_FILES['file']['name'];
$tmp_name = $_FILES['file']['tmp_name'];
$file_size = $_FILES['file']['size'];
$file_type = $_FILES['file']['type'];
}
$filename=str_replace(" ","_","$file_name");
if(copy("$tmp_name","files/$filename")){
$strSQL = "INSERT INTO files ";
$strSQL.= "(file_name,file_size,file_type,creator,create_date,user_update,update_date) ";
$strSQL.= "VALUES ('$filename','$file_size','$file_type',".$_SESSION['SESUser_ID'];
$strSQL.= ",now(),".$_SESSION['SESUser_ID'].",now())";
$objQuery = mysql_query($strSQL) or die ("x3".mysql_error());*/
if($objQuery)
{
echo "<script> alert('อัพโหลดไฟล์เรียบร้อยแล้ว : ".$file_name."');</script>";
}
else{echo"<script>alert('<font color='red'>ไม่สามารถอัพโหลดไฟล์ได้</font>');</script>";}
$query = mysql_query($sql) or die(mysql_error());
?>
<script language="javascript">
alert("กรอกข้อมูลเรียบร้อยแล้ว");
window.location = "?main=ag_member";
</script>
<?php }} ?>
Tag : PHP
|
|
|
|
|
|
Date :
2013-03-09 23:28:20 |
By :
FREEDOOM |
View :
771 |
Reply :
2 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
เปลี่ยนรูปแบบการเขียนใหม่ครับ
Code (PHP)
<?
if(move_uploaded_file($_FILES["filUpload"]["tmp_name"],"myfile/".$_FILES["filUpload"]["name"]))
{
echo "Copy/Upload Complete<br>";
//*** Insert Record ***//
$objConnect = mysql_connect("localhost","root","root") or die("Error Connect to Database");
$objDB = mysql_select_db("mydatabase");
$strSQL = "INSERT INTO files ";
$strSQL .="(FilesName) VALUES ('".$_FILES["filUpload"]["name"]."')";
$objQuery = mysql_query($strSQL);
}
?>
จะต้องใช้ $_FILES["xyz"]
|
|
|
|
|
Date :
2013-03-10 07:26:16 |
By :
mr.win |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Load balance : Server 02
|